MoneyGram International Inc. reported second-quarter revenue of $410 million, flat with 2016’s second quarter on a constant-currency basis. Digital money-transfer revenue increased 10% and now accounts for 15% of total money-transfer revenue. Net income doubled to $6.2 million. Payments provider National Merchants Association announced it is using the PhoeniXGate gateway from Phoenix Managed Networks. Fleetcor Technologies Inc., a vendor of commercial-payment technology, reported second-quarter results, including a year-over-year increase of 29.5% in total revenue to $541.2 million and GAAP net income of $131 million, up 12.7%.
